My Story


I grew up in Belgium surrounded by Natural Medicine. My father was a Chiropractor, Oriental Medical Doctor, and Physical Therapist who integrated Functional Medicine with a variety of innovative modalities. Long before these approaches became mainstream, he incorporated Laser Therapy, Ear Acupuncture, Applied Kinesiology, and Homeopathy into his practice. His patients ranged from individuals with complex health conditions to world-class athletes. At home, I was raised with nutrient-dense local foods, along with daily vitamins, herbs, and homeopathic remedies.


As a child, I struggled with asthma, allergies, and eczema. I was treated by a Medical Doctor specializing in Classical Homeopathy—a therapy that profoundly improved my health. This experience not only transformed my wellbeing, but ultimately shaped the direction of my life and my career in medicine.


After completing my Pre-Medical Studies at Richmond College in London, I moved to the United States to attend the National College of Chiropractic in Chicago. I quickly realized how much there was to learn within the field and embraced every opportunity for advanced study. I trained extensively in Applied Kinesiology (A.K.) with Dr. Wally Smith, D.C., and George Goodheart, D.C., the founder of A.K. I explored Magnet Therapy through the work of Dr. Earl Colum, D.C., and refined my skills in Clinical Kinesiology with Dr. Craig Hilgendorf, D.C. 


My studies continued with Dietrich Klinghardt, M.D., in Autonomic Response Testing, and Dr. Thomas Rau, M.D., one of the world’s most respected physicians in biological medicine.


Homeopathy


My passion for Classical Homeopathy deepened when I discovered a homeopathic pharmacy that preserved original books and remedies from the era of Dr. James Tyler Kent—renowned for teaching Materia Medica at major homeopathic institutions from the late 1800s into the early 1900s. I immersed myself in these texts, studying every volume I could find.

My formal training began with André Saine, N.D., D.C., and Francisco Xavier Eizayaga, M.D. Later, on the West Coast, I was fortunate to learn from some of the greatest homeopathic masters of our time, including Ananda Zaren, Roger Morrison, M.D., Nancy Herrick, Jan Scholten, M.D., Massimo Mangialavori, M.D., Rajan Sankaran, Lou Klein, and Michal Yakir.  


Naturopathic Medicine


A few years into my clinical practice, I returned to school to expand my training in natural therapeutics. The National College of Naturopathic Medicine in Portland, Oregon—home to the largest homeopathic library in the country—was the ideal place to deepen my knowledge. I completed my Doctorate in Naturopathic Medicine to better serve patients with comprehensive and integrative care. I advanced my naturopathic education over the years to include IV Therapies, Dark Field Microscopy and European Thermography.


Functional Medicine


I began studying Functional Medicine with Jeffrey Bland in 1991, at the very inception of the field. Functional Medicine brought together the biochemistry I had learned in school and translated it into powerful, individualized strategies for patient care. It expanded my understanding of how nutrition, supplementation, and botanical extracts can influence cellular function and even modulate genetic expression.

Early Career


Before establishing my practice in Santa Barbara in 1996 I served as an associate to Dr. Craig Hilgendorf, D.C., in Wheaton, Illinois. I was also part of the founding team of the Chicago Holistic Center—now Whole Health Chicago—one of the first integrative medical centers in the United States, directed by David Edelberg, M.D.
